Output 7660f604b3e2a210b94ee0157edb9c96b68aa4eaf9addbf529d566ee9bc50cfe:0

value
1425960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d21563804928a64de8c84a567a2570b4306e115 OP_EQUAL
address
3ABShfX2rFCDxdCcaAsK5RXVXcYx3xcXyc
transaction
7660f604b3e2a210b94ee0157edb9c96b68aa4eaf9addbf529d566ee9bc50cfe
spent
true